The locally linear embedding (LLE) algorithm has recently emerged as a promising technique for nonlinear dimensionality reduction of high-dimensional data. One of its advantages over many similar methods is that only one parameter has to be defined, but no guidance was yet given how to choose it. Manifold learning is the process of estimating a low-dimensional structure which underlies a collection of high-dimensional data. Here we review two popular methods for nonlinear dimensionality reduction, locally linear embedding (LLE, [1]) and IsoMap [2]. Manifold learning techniques are used to preserve the original geometry of dataset after reduction by preserving the distance among data points. MDS (Multidimensional Scaling), ISOMAP (Isometric Feature Mapping), LLE (Locally Linear Embedding) are some of the geometrical structure preserving dimension reduction methods.
